Exact trigonometric values keep answers in surd or fractional form, avoiding premature rounding.

The identity sin² x + cos² x = 1 lets you recover one ratio from another, but the quadrant determines its sign.

Watch out

  • Taking both signs without using the stated quadrant.
  • Rounding an exact surd or fraction.

Exam reminder

For exact values and identities, show the defining equation or formula before simplifying. Check that every final value satisfies the original restrictions, interval or context.
